Step 1: Inspect the Hinge
Begin by checking the hinge for any visible damage. Try to find rust, bent pins, or other uncommon wear. Make certain to also check that the screws are tight. If they are loose, merely tighten them with a screwdriver.
Step 2: Lubricate the Hinge
If you observe squeaking or difficulty in unlocking, use a lube such as WD-40. Spray a little quantity directly onto the hinge and open and close the door a number of times to work the lubricant into the system.
Step 3: Realign the Door
If the door does not close effectively, it may be misaligned. Using a level, check if the door is hang straight in the frame. If it is not, you may need to adjust the hinges by loosening up the screws and rearranging the door.
Step 4: Repair or Replace the Hinge
If the hinge is damaged, you will need to change it. Here's how:
Remove the old hinge: Unscrew the harmed hinge from the door and the frame.Prep the area: If the screw holes are stripped, you may require to fill them with wood filler and let it dry.Set up the brand-new hinge: Position the new hinge and protect it with screws. Guarantee that it's lined up appropriately before tightening.Step 5: Test the Repair
After completing the repair, test the door by opening and closing it a few times. Inspect for any remaining issues such as sound or misalignment.

A1: It's recommended to oil your door hinges at least once a year or whenever you discover squeaking.
Q2: What should I do if my hinges are still squeaking after lubrication?
A2: If the hinges continue to squeak, check them for damage or rust. You may require to replace them if they are improperly damaged.
Q3: Can I change a hinge myself?
A3: Yes, replacing a hinge is a simple DIY task that can be finished with standard tools and products.
Q4: How do I understand if my hinge is broken?
